Summary:
Mojtaba Khamenei was named Iran’s supreme leader following the death of his father, Ali Khamenei, in a targeted Israeli strike on February 28. According to Israeli national security sources and defense analyst Kobi Michael, Mojtaba is described as an "empty entity" who does not control or lead the currently "misfunctioning" Iranian regime. Mojtaba has not made any public appearances since his appointment, and reports indicate he narrowly escaped death during the strike, sustaining a minor leg injury. Israeli strikes have also targeted other senior Iranian officials, and Western analysts suggest these actions aim to weaken the regime’s stability and limit its influence in the Middle East.

Iran’s new supreme leader, Mojtaba Khamenei, is little more than an "empty entity" who is not at the helm of the regime, according to Israeli national security sources.The son of Ayatollah Ali Khamenei — who was killed in a targeted Israeli strike on Feb. 28 — is also linked to what officials describe as a "misfunctioning" regime."The new leader is an empty entity," Kobi Michael, a defense analyst at the Institute for National Security Studies and the Misgav Institute, told Fox News Digital."Mojtaba Khamenei does not appear in public, but we also have reliable information that he does not control or lead the regime — or what has been left of the regime.""The current Iranian leadership is broken, confused and is almost misfunctioning," Michael added.TRUMP VOWS TO HIT IRAN 'VERY HARD' AFTER OBLITERATING NEARLY '90 PERCENT' OF REGIME MISSILESMojtaba reportedly escaped death by minutes when his father was killed Feb. 28, leaving the compound for a walk shortly before an Israeli missile strike, according to leaked audio accessed by The Telegraph.The audio — reportedly from a Mar. 12 meeting — revealed details about the strikes that also took out several members of the Khamenei family.Ma...
